Rev. Donald Keith Newkirk

Jun 11, 1963 — Jul 27, 2026

Rev. Donald Keith Newkirk, 63, passed away peacefully on July 27, 2026, in Ocala, Florida, while surrounded by his family. He was born June 11, 1963, the son of Lewis and Joyce Newkirk.

Don’s love of classic cars was only surpassed by his love for his family, animals, and his service to God, having spent most of his life preaching the gospel in churches across Appalachia. Whether repairing a dent on a Chrysler Cordoba or performing baptisms in a lake, Don spent his time helping others maintain their earthly vessels with care and dedication.

On the first page of his Bible, the same well-worn book he’d carried to pulpits and bedsides throughout his life, he had written a quote that defined his calling:

“The quality of one’s life is determined not by its duration, but by its donation.”

Don leaves behind a legacy of devotion, humor, and love, and will be sorely missed by the countless lives he enriched.

He was preceded in death by his father, Lewis Newkirk, and his son, Zachery Newkirk.

He is survived by his wife, Patricia Newkirk; son, Greg Newkirk; daughter, Katie Campbell; son, Nicholas Newkirk; grandchildren, Riley and Ellie Campbell; sister, Wendie Newkirk; and mother, Joyce Newkirk.

Countryside has been entrusted with the final arrangements.
